Developer Guides
Welcome to the Document Engine developer guides. These guides show how to add document processing functionality to server-side applications using our API, as well as how to integrate with PSPDFKit’s frontend SDKs on Web, iOS, and Android.
If you’re brand new to PSPDFKit, have a look at our get started guides to quickly add PDF generation, editing, and redaction to your application.
Guides
Configuration
How to customize some of Document Engine’s options
File Management
How to migrate and create documents for Document Engine
Deployment
How to deploy on Kubernetes via a Helm chart
Management
How to use the built-in dashboard
Monitoring
How to use Document Engine’s monitoring capabilities
Viewer (UI Integration)
Learn about the optional integrated document viewers
PDF Generation
How to generate PDFs and fillable PDF forms
Conversion
How to convert from Microsoft Office to PDF and more
OCR
How to make scans searchable, extract text from images, and more
Annotations
How to import and flatten annotations, and more
Forms
How to create a PDF form, fill form fields, extract data, and more
Editor
How to merge documents, manipulate or add pages, and more
Signatures
How to add digital signatures to PDF documents
Redaction
How to redact content programmatically
Extraction
How to extract content and structured data from documents
Optimization
How to compress and shrink PDF documents
PDF/A
How to convert into PDF/A and validate conformance
MS Office
How to view, convert, and generate MS Office documents
Rendering
How to render a PDF page to a bitmap or thumbnail
Instant JSON
Learn how to store annotation data in JSON format